A PENSIONER cyclist has died after being hit by a hit-and-run driver in Hampshire.
Police are appealing for information after the 70-year-old man died of head injuries he suffered in the collision, which happened on the A338 at Fordingbridge last month.
The white Transit van captured in CCTV images is believed to be the one involved in the crash and has the licence plate number BU53 FVM.
Officers have stopped hundreds of drivers as part of their investigation and are asking anyone with information to get in touch.
